Both Clay Pigeon Shooting and Archery are challenging tests of hand/eye co-ordination and reaction speed. In the events at Armathwaite Hall Hotel and Spa, the clays would be released to mimic the unpredictable nature of live birds by alternating between trajectories, angles, speed etc. Unlike game shooting, clay pigeon shooting can be enjoyed year-round, making it perfect in the somewhat changeable conditions of the Lake District and the added bonus of Archery Instruction ensures we can provide pursuits for all ages and abilities.
